On the energy transition, the Municipality of Isili joins forces with Genoni and Nurallao: they have appealed to the Regional Administrative Court (TAR) against the "Isili 2" photovoltaic plant.

The city council recently unanimously approved filing a lawsuit challenging the Ministerial Decree authorizing construction of a mega-plant with a capacity of over 33 MWp.

"These projects were planned from above," said Isili Mayor Luca Pilia. "We are ready to defend our territory together with the surrounding communities."

The goal is to obtain the annulment, subject to emergency suspension, of the ministerial decree issued last May by the Ministry of the Environment and Energy Security.

The "Isili2" project includes a ground-mounted photovoltaic system complete with storage systems and related grid connection, proposed by VenSar Srl. But the Isili community won't act alone; the opposition is shared and coordinated with the Genoni and Nurallao administrations.

"We are faced with yet another top-down project," the administrations reiterated. "The value of the energy transition is not being contested, but this cannot happen at the expense of communities and territorial planning."

A firm position therefore supported by defects of legitimacy, investigative shortcomings and technical observations that will be brought before the TAR.
